320 /* Volume mapping. We consider left, right, volume to be in [0,1]
321 * and balance to be in [-1,1].
323 * First, we just have volume = max(left, right).
325 * Balance we consider to linearly represent the amount by which the quieter
326 * channel differs from the louder. In detail:
328 * if right > left then balance > 0:
329 * balance = 0 => left = right (as an endpoint, not an instance)
330 * balance = 1 => left = 0
331 * fitting to linear, left = right * (1 - balance)
332 * so balance = 1 - left / right
333 * (right > left => right > 0 so no division by 0.)
335 * if left > right then balance < 0:
336 * balance = 0 => right = left (same caveat as above)
337 * balance = -1 => right = 0
338 * again fitting to linear, right = left * (1 + balance)
339 * so balance = right / left - 1
340 * (left > right => left > 0 so no division by 0.)
342 * if left = right then we just have balance = 0.
344 * Thanks to Clive and Andrew.
